Lansarea EasyOS 4.0, distribuția originală de la creatorul Puppy Linux

Barry Kauler, fondatorul proiectului Puppy Linux, a publicat o distribuție experimentală EasyOS 4.0 care combină tehnologiile Puppy Linux cu izolarea containerizată pentru a rula componentele sistemului. Kitul de distribuție este gestionat printr-un set de configuratoare grafice dezvoltate de proiect. Dimensiunea imaginii de boot este de 773 MB.

Caracteristici de distribuție:

  • Fiecare aplicație, precum și desktopul în sine, pot fi rulate în containere separate, care sunt izolate folosind mecanismul propriu al Easy Containers.
  • Rulează ca root în mod implicit cu resetarea privilegiilor la pornirea fiecărei aplicații, deoarece EasyOS este poziționat ca sistem Live al unui utilizator (opțional este posibil să ruleze sub „locul” utilizator neprivilegiat).
  • Distribuția este instalată într-un subdirector separat și poate coexista cu alte date de pe unitate (sistemul este instalat în /releases/easy-4.0, datele utilizatorului sunt stocate în directorul /home și containere de aplicații suplimentare sunt plasate în /containers director).
  • Criptarea subdirectoarelor individuale (de exemplu, /home) este acceptată.
  • Este posibil să instalați meta-pachete în format SFS, care sunt imagini montabile cu Squashfs care combină mai multe pachete obișnuite.
  • Sistemul este actualizat în modul atomic (noua versiune este copiată într-un alt director și directorul activ cu sistemul este comutat) și acceptă rollback-ul modificărilor în cazul unor probleme după actualizare.
  • Există o rulare din modul RAM în care sistemul este copiat în memorie la pornire și rulează fără accesarea discurilor.
  • Pentru a construi distribuția, se utilizează setul de instrumente WoofQ și sursele de pachete din proiectul OpenEmbedded.
  • Desktopul se bazează pe managerul de ferestre JWM și managerul de fișiere ROX.
    Lansarea EasyOS 4.0, distribuția originală de la creatorul Puppy Linux
  • Pachetul de bază include aplicații precum Firefox, LibreOffice, Scribus, Inkscape, GIMP, mtPaint, Dia, Gpicview, Geany text editor, Fagaros password manager, HomeBank personal finance management system, DidiWiki personal wiki, Osmo organizer, Planner project manager, system Notecase , Pigin, player muzical Audacious, playere media Celuloid, VLC și MPV, editor video LiVES, sistem de streaming OBS Studio.
  • Pentru partajarea ușoară a fișierelor și partajarea imprimantei, este oferită o aplicație nativă EasyShare.

În noua versiune:

  • Au fost făcute modificări structurale semnificative, care au făcut posibilă accelerarea lansării programelor și creșterea capacității de răspuns a interfeței. Se observă că este destul de posibil să lucrezi cu kitul de distribuție pe un sistem cu 2 GB RAM.
  • S-a oprit distribuirea imaginii izo în formă comprimată pentru a simplifica copierea acesteia pe suport.
  • În funcționare normală, toate operațiunile sunt efectuate în RAM fără a fi scrise pe disc.
  • Pe desktop, pictograma Salvare este propusă pentru o resetare neprogramată a rezultatelor muncii stocate în RAM pe unitate (în modul normal, modificările sunt salvate la sfârșitul sesiunii).
  • Algoritmul lz4-hc este utilizat pentru a comprima sistemul de fișiere Squashfs, care, combinat cu lucrul din RAM, a făcut posibilă accelerarea semnificativă a lansării aplicațiilor și a containerelor.
  • Sistemul este complet reconstruit din OpenEmbedded-Quirky (reviziunea-9). Nucleul Linux a fost actualizat la versiunea 5.15.44.

Sursa: opennet.ru

Adauga un comentariu